Welcome to historic Harry's Cabin at Stout’s Island Lodge, where you will experience unmatched tranquility at one of the only Adirondack-Style Great Lodges outside of Upstate New York. Rarely available, Harry's is a spacious cabin that consists of approximately 1,550 square feet, and which has 2 bedrooms and 3 bathrooms and which features a full kitchen, private deck & three-season porch. This cabin stands on the south side of the Main Lodge, overlooking the south lawn and lake. The cabin is well-situated to access many of the key features of the Island. Stout’s Island Lodge was originally built in the early 1900s as the estate of Chicago-based lumber baron Frank D. Stout, and Harry's Cabin was originally built for Frank D. Stout’s son. This iconic property, also known as the "Island of Happy Days," offers a one-of-a-kind blend of rustic elegance, modern comforts, and breathtaking scenery. The lodge has welcomed guests for over a century, offering a rich history and unmatched character. The property encompasses over 17 acres between the two private islands that are connected by a steel bridge that was donated by Andrew Carnegie. Enjoy meticulously maintained walking trails, pristine waterfront views, and lush landscapes as you explore the islands. Some of the activities available include kayaking, boating, fishing, hiking, tennis, yard games, billiards, table tennis, a full service bar, campfires under the stars, and several nearby golf courses. The island can be accessed year-round via boat (ferry rides available every hour, or on demand), air boat, or an ice road and is only two quick hours from the Twin Cities.
